简介
ChatGPT是一种基于大型神经网络的聊天机器人,具有生成对话的能力。本文将介绍如何制作ChatGPT,包括所需的步骤、工具和技术。
制作ChatGPT的步骤
制作ChatGPT涉及以下步骤:
- 收集对话数据集
- 准备数据集
- 训练神经网络
- 部署模型
收集对话数据集
在制作ChatGPT之前,首先需要收集包含对话内容的数据集。可以从互联网上获取公开的对话语料库,也可以自己创建对话数据集。
准备数据集
对收集的对话数据集进行预处理,包括数据清洗、分词和格式转换等操作。确保数据集的质量和格式符合训练要求。
训练神经网络
使用深度学习框架(如TensorFlow、PyTorch)构建ChatGPT的神经网络模型,并利用准备好的数据集进行模型训练。调参和优化模型以获得更好的对话生成效果。
部署模型
训练好的ChatGPT模型可以部署在服务器上,通过API接口或其他方式与用户进行交互,实现对话生成的功能。
制作ChatGPT所需工具和技术
制作ChatGPT需要以下工具和技术:
- 深度学习框架(如TensorFlow、PyTorch)
- 对话数据集
- 训练硬件(GPU加速器)
- 服务器(用于部署模型)
常见问题FAQ
如何获得对话数据集?
对话数据集可以通过公开的对话语料库或自行收集对话录音等方式获得。
ChatGPT的训练时间有多长?
ChatGPT的训练时间取决于数据集大小、模型复杂度和训练硬件等因素,一般需要数天甚至数周。
如何优化ChatGPT的生成效果?
可以通过调整模型架构、超参数设置和增加训练数据等方式优化ChatGPT的生成效果。
结论
通过本文的介绍,您可以了解如何制作ChatGPT,并掌握制作ChatGPT所需的步骤、工具和技术。希望本文能够帮助您顺利制作ChatGPT,实现自定义的聊天机器人功能。
正文完